conchahockenParticipantNow that the lottery is behind us, Philly is going to have plenty of options this offseason. clearly, it starts with one of Simmons or Ingram.
Let’s assume Philly goes to Simmons…Now you have a largely crowded frontcourt and still an absence of guards and shooters on the wing. With the new regime BC is bringing in, you know they will be active in at least attempting to add talent in these positions.
A prime buy low target I think could help the program is Brandon Knight. Is he your typical lead guard? absolutely not. But I think with having Simmons assuming some of the PG responsibilites, a guy like Knight who would has voiced his displeasure of being the 6th man due to the emergence of Devin Booker at the 2, would have a great deal of success at the de facto PG for Philly. Remember, he is still just 24 yo. But, Knight with his contract and attitude seems like the odd man out.
I think it’s a great buy low opportunity for Philly to address a couple needs. What would it take to get him? One of Covington/Holmes/Grant + 24th pick?
Philly would still have Okafor, their first next year, Lakers first to dangle, if Chicago was interested in bringing Oak home.
